Reflections Beneath Quiet Canopies explores the delicate relationship between nature, memory and abstraction through the expressive language of ink on paper. Bold organic forms suggest clusters of trees standing beside calm water, while soft washes dissolve into generous areas of negative space, allowing the composition to breathe naturally.
The mirrored reflections create visual balance and reinforce the feeling of stillness, while warm sienna blooms introduce subtle warmth amid charcoal blacks and muted greys. Rather than describing a particular location, the artwork evokes the emotional memory of peaceful wetlands or riverside landscapes experienced through intuition rather than observation.
Its spontaneous ink diffusion, fluid textures and restrained palette celebrate the unpredictable beauty of the medium. Care Instructions
- Display away from direct sunlight to preserve the integrity of the ink.
- Frame using UV-protective glass and acid-free archival mounting materials.
- Avoid humid environments and extreme temperature fluctuations.
- Dust only the outer frame with a soft microfiber cloth.
- Never use water or cleaning chemicals on the artwork.
- Handle with clean hands or cotton gloves to prevent transferring oils.
- Store flat or in a protective archival portfolio when not displayed.
